The Indian men's golf team was tied fifth and the women were eighth after the first round of the team event of the 17th Asian Games at the Dream Park Country Club here Thursday.
The men's team comprising Feroz Garewal (70), Udayan Mane (70), Samarth Dwivedi (71) and Manu Gandas (71) returned with a card of 211. The three best scores were taken into account.
In the individual round, Garewal and Mane were tied ninth with two under 70 while Dwivedi and Gandas were tied 20th with one under 71 and all four are within close distance of the leader Cheng Tsung Pan of Chinese Taipei, who carded a six-under 66.
In the women's team event, the trio of Astha Madan (75), Gurbani Singh (75) and Aditi Ashok (78) were tied eighth with a score of 150 after the two best scores were taken into account. Gurbani and Astha were tied ninth while Aditi was tied 22nd in the individual category.
